  • I Have Purchased a Forestwest 15ton Log Splitter BM11097. I plan on using this Log Splitter as part of my Firewood Processing set up. Its a Electric Log Splitter with a 2200 watt Electric motor. In this video i open the Box/ Pallet it came in, assemble the legs as it is the upgrade version and give it a test run with some Australian Hardwood, Easy splitting narrow-leaved peppermint (Eucalyptus radiata) and some Very hard splitting Plantation Bluegum (Eucalyptus Globulus).

    I have the 26T version which has proven to be excellent - it was very rarely unable to split anything we chucked at it - with 2 caveats... The mechanism that engages the rack and pinion to 'fire' the splitter 'head' failed after about 5T of logs due to a poorly designed component which suffered metal fatigue The fix was extremely easy (using a pair of sheep castration bands, funnily enough) and has worked fine for the last 2 years (and another 40T or so of logs) until a novice operator managed to burn the motor out. So, I'm looking for a new motor now. The amount of petrol we must have saved using this rather than the old hydraulic 3-point linkage-mounted thing that we used to use... And the electricity cost is is tiny by comparison.
